The Isbell family and possibly the family’s enslaved people built a distillery.Ĭensus and real estate records show that a wide variety of people lived in and around Jollification. Jollification was founded about 18 miles east of Neosho, about 40 acres of land purchased from the Isbell family, according to Roots Web and Digging History.
